Trickle-down economics is a term used in critical references to economic policies to say they disproportionately favor the upper end of the economic spectrum, i.e. wealthy investors and large corporations. In recent history, the term has been used broadly by critics of supply-side economics. WebSep 22, 2024 · Trickle down economics. 22 September 2024 by Tejvan Pettinger. Trickle down economics is a term used to describe the belief that if high-income earners gain an increase in salary, then everyone in the economy will benefit as their increased income and wealth filter through to all sections in society.

Trickle migration is the migration of data in small increments, hence the name ‘trickle’. The data is broken down and organised in chunks to carry out the migration for each separately.
